Chelsea boss Benitez: Man Utd may have been relaxing

Chelsea's Rafael Benitez feels Manchester United may have relaxed slightly after winning the Premier League title.

The Blues kept their Champions League qualification hopes well and truly alive with a 1-0 victory at Old Trafford today with Benitez suggesting Sir Alex Ferguson's men may have been in cruise control after securing their 20th league title.

"When the goal came we were really pleased and convinced it was an important step forward," said the Spaniard.

"Obviously United, after winning the title, normally you can expect they are a little bit more relaxed.

"My team talk at half-time was trying to increase the tempo because I could see we were controlling, doing well but were still missing the high tempo that is necessary if you want to beat a team like United.

"I think we did it in the second half. It still wasn't perfect but enough for winning the game."

The only goal of the contest came in the 87th minute when Juan Mata fired goalward from an angle with the ball taking a deflection off Phil Jones and edging in off the post.
